Maryland HB 785 (2022) — Courts - Baltimore City Jobs Court Pilot Program and Circuit Court Real Property Records Improvement Fund

Version chain

The bill's text revisions, in order — the diff chain from filing to enrollment.

  1. Chapter - Courts - Baltimore City Jobs Court Pilot Program and Circuit Court Real Property Records Improvement Fund (committee substitute) — source
  2. Enrolled - Courts - Baltimore City Jobs Court Pilot Program and Circuit Court Real Property Records Improvement Fund (committee substitute) — source
  3. First - Baltimore City District Court Jobs Court Pilot Program (committee substitute) — source
  4. Third - Baltimore City District Court Jobs Court Pilot Program (committee substitute) — source

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2022-02-03 First Reading Judiciary referral-committee
  • 2022-02-03 Hearing 2/15 at 1:00 p.m.
  • 2022-03-17 Favorable with Amendments Report by Judiciary committee-passage-favorable
  • 2022-03-17 Favorable with Amendments { committee-passage-favorable
  • 2022-03-17 Second Reading Passed with Amendments
  • 2022-03-18 Third Reading Passed passage
  • 2022-03-18 Referred Judicial Proceedings Budget and Taxation referral-committee
  • 2022-04-08 Favorable with Amendments Report by Judicial Proceedings committee-passage-favorable
  • 2022-04-08 Favorable with Amendments { committee-passage-favorable
  • 2022-04-08 Second Reading Passed with Amendments
  • 2022-04-09 Third Reading Passed passage
  • 2022-04-11 House Concurs Senate Amendments
  • 2022-04-11 Third Reading Passed passage
  • 2022-04-11 Passed Enrolled
  • 2022-05-29 Enacted under Article II, Section 17(c) of the Maryland Constitution - Chapter 522 became-law
